What is Docusate Sodium and How Does It Work?

Docusate Sodium is a surfactant, a type of stool softener (or emollient laxative) that works differently from stimulant laxatives. Instead of forcing the intestines to contract, it helps water and fats mix into the stool. This process reduces the surface tension of the stool, allowing it to absorb more water from the colon. The result is a softer, bulkier stool that is easier and more comfortable to pass. This mechanism of action makes it an excellent option for constipation relief in situations where straining should be avoided, such as after surgery, during pregnancy, or for individuals with hemorrhoids or heart conditions.

Benefits of Choosing a Docusate Sodium-Based Stool Softener

Opting for a stool softener containing Docusate Sodium offers several distinct advantages. First and foremost is its gentle action. It does not cause cramping or sudden urgency, which is common with stimulant laxatives. This makes it predictable and suitable for regular use under a doctor's guidance. Secondly, it is non-habit forming, meaning it doesn't lead to dependency or "lazy bowel" syndrome when used as directed. Its primary role is to facilitate a natural bowel movement by addressing the dryness and hardness of the stool, making it a cornerstone of digestive health management for many.

Common Uses and Who Can Benefit

Docusate Sodium is versatile and recommended for various scenarios. It is frequently used for short-term relief of occasional constipation. Healthcare professionals often recommend it for patients recovering from childbirth or rectal surgery to prevent straining. It's also a common component of bowel preparation regimens before certain medical procedures. Individuals with conditions like hemorrhoids, anal fissures, or high blood pressure, where minimizing Valsalva maneuver (straining) is important, may find this laxative softgels particularly beneficial. However, it is not intended for long-term use without medical supervision.

How to Use Docusate Sodium Safely and Effectively

To maximize the benefits and ensure safety, proper usage is essential. Always take the medication with a full 8-ounce glass of water or other fluid. Adequate hydration throughout the day is critical, as Docusate Sodium works by helping water enter the stool; without sufficient fluid intake, its effectiveness is diminished. Do not crush, chew, or break the softgels. It is best taken as part of a daily routine. Remember, this is a reliever, not a preventative. For chronic constipation, a healthcare provider should address underlying causes related to diet, fiber intake, activity level, and digestive health.

Potential Side Effects and Precautions

While generally well-tolerated, Docusate Sodium can cause side effects in some individuals. The most common are mild stomach cramping or a feeling of fullness. Diarrhea or throat irritation can occur if the softgel is not swallowed properly with enough water. Serious side effects are rare but can include severe stomach pain, rectal bleeding, or an allergic reaction. It's important to disclose all medications to your doctor, as Docusate Sodium can interact with mineral oil and certain other drugs. Do not use it if you have symptoms of appendicitis or intestinal blockage, such as severe nausea, vomiting, or abdominal pain.

Integrating Stool Softeners into a Holistic Digestive Health Plan

A product like the Amazon Basic Care Stool Softener is a tool, not a cure-all. For lasting constipation relief and optimal digestive health, it should be part of a broader strategy. This includes increasing dietary fiber from f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, drinking plenty of fluids, and engaging in regular physical activity. Establishing a regular bathroom routine and not ignoring the urge to have a bowel movement are also key habits. A stool softener can help manage symptoms while you make these positive lifestyle changes.
